log file = /var/log/samba/%U.%m.log


It works fine here, since Samba 2.x. Actually I use it the reverse way:
%m.%U.log

Some files are created as "machinename..log", without username, but I
suppose that's normal: they are probably used to log events taking place
when no user has been authenticated yet, or something like that.
